Embodiment: a kind of building fire protection facility networking monitoring linkage extinguishing system such as Fig. 1 and Fig. 2, including is set to building
Fire detection mechanism 1 and fire suppression mechanism 2 in object.Fire detection mechanism 1 includes being distributed in each position in building
Smoke detector 11, in 11 20 centimetres of smoke detector of distance be equipped with heat detector 12 and infrared detection unit
13, central controller 14 is equipped in the fire fighting monitoring room of building.If any one in heat detector 12 and smoke detector 11
It is a to detect fire signal, then signal feedback is issued to central controller 14, central controller 14 controls infrared detection unit 13
Start and detect heat source position, if forming fire source, starts fire suppression mechanism 2 and fire source is put out.
Such as Fig. 2 and Fig. 3, fire suppression mechanism 2 includes fire protection pipeline 21 and the linkage being connected on fire protection pipeline 21 spray
First 20, linkage spray head 20 includes the distributive pipe road 22 being connected to fire protection pipeline 21, and distributive pipe road 22 is equipped with the first outlet pipe 221
With the second outlet pipe 222, fire extinguishing sprayer 4 is equipped at the second outlet pipe 222, fire extinguishing sprayer 4 includes being rotatably connected on the second water outlet
Cross section on 222 outer wall of pipe is circular spin-block 41, offers the cavity 42 being connected to the second outlet pipe 222 in spin-block 41
(such as Fig. 4) offers strip hole 43(such as Fig. 5 on spin-block 41), jet pipe 44 is equipped in strip hole 43.
Such as Fig. 4, jet pipe 44 is hinged between the hole wall of strip hole 43 by articulated shaft 45, so that jet pipe 44 can be in strip
Rotation in hole 43, distributive pipe road 22 are equipped with rubber sleave 46 towards one end of jet pipe 44, and the both ends of rubber sleave 46 are locked respectively
On distributive pipe road 22 and jet pipe 44, so that water flow can pass sequentially through rubber sleave 46 and spray head when distributive pipe road 22 intakes
After spray, and then fire source is put out.
Such as Fig. 4, spin-block 41 is equipped with the first actuator 5 that driving spin-block 41 rotates and driving jet pipe 44 rotate second and drives
Moving part 6, the first actuator 5 include being fixed at spin-block 41 away from the first motor 51 of 44 side of jet pipe and being connected to first
First gear 52 on 51 output end of motor is connected with second gear 53,52 He of first gear on the outer wall of second outlet pipe 222
Second gear 53 is meshed, and when the first motor 51 works, first gear 52 can be driven to rotate, at this time due to 52 He of first gear
Second gear 53 is meshed, so that the spin-block 41 connecting with the first motor 51 can be fast automatic around the second outlet pipe
222 rotations;Second actuator 6 includes the third gear 62 that is connected on articulated shaft 45, and the is fixedly connected on 41 outer wall of spin-block
Two motor 61 is connected with the 4th gear 64 being meshed with third gear 62, the second motor 61 on the output end of second motor 61
When work, the 4th gear 64 can be driven to rotate, at this time since third gear 62 and the 4th gear 64 are meshed, thus and third
The articulated shaft 45 that gear 62 connects can rotate, and then drive jet pipe 44 is fast automatic to rotate around articulated shaft 45.Due to rotation
Block 41 is different with the rotational plane of jet pipe 44, therefore be free to realize comprehensive injection, in infrared detection unit 13
The fire source of different angle is directed at and put out under guide, improves fire-fighting efficiency.
Such as Fig. 4, several inconsistent with 46 inside of rubber sleave anti-entangle peripherally is fixedly connected on the second outlet pipe 222
Piece 8 prevents that entangling piece 8 inwardly triggers far from one end of the second outlet pipe 222 and formed a radian, to reduce to rubber sleave 46
Friction.It is each it is anti-entangle one end that piece 8 triggers and be connected by ring bar 81, to form an entirety, each prevent entangling piece 8 to improve
Structural strength and anti-pressure ability.For spin-block 41 in rotation, rubber sleave 46 can generate distortion, it is anti-at this time entangle piece 8 can be to rubber
Rubber sleeve 46 plays the role of an expansion position, so that rubber sleave 46 can only be distorted in anti-entangle outside piece 8, to ensure that rubber sleave
46 internal diameter, and then ensure that the water yield of jet pipe 44.
Such as Fig. 6, be connected with drencher 3 on the first outlet pipe 221, drencher 3 be set as it is trapezoidal and drencher 3 go out
Water end (W.E.) size is larger, and the water outlet of drencher 3 is set as prolate type and extends outwardly, and passes through the water of the first outlet pipe 221 at this time
Stream will form one of water curtain when spraying from the water outlet of drencher 3, several drenchers 3 near fire source work at the same time then
It can will be wrapped up around fire source with water curtain, to can not only slow down the speed of fire spreading, but also fire and smoke spread can be reduced
Possibility in whole building, when substantially increasing fire generation, the success rate of personnel escape in building.Drencher 3
Water outlet be equipped with the water diversing sheet 31 that water flow is split into two halves along its length, the two sides of water diversing sheet 31 are set as to the oblique of external diffusion
Face greatly improves the fire-proof smoke insulation performance of water curtain so as to form two water curtains at an angle.
Such as Fig. 4, it is equipped with solenoid valve 7 on the first outlet pipe 221 and the second outlet pipe 222, if fire source intensity is smaller, the
Solenoid valve 7 on one outlet pipe 221 is closed, and the solenoid valve 7 on the second outlet pipe 222 is opened, and is poured to concentrate to fire source
It goes out, if fire source intensity is larger, fire extinguishing sprayer 4 is difficult to put out, then the solenoid valve 7 on the second outlet pipe 222 is closed, the first outlet pipe
Solenoid valve 7 on 221 is opened, so that the bigger water curtain of water is formed, to slow down the speed of fire spreading, to personnel in building
Strive for more fleeing from the time.
The course of work: when fire occurs, smoke detector 11 and heat detector 12 are sounded an alarm to central controller 14
Signal, central controller 14 controls infrared detection unit 13 and works at this time, and infrared detection unit 13 starts and detect heat source position,
If forming fire source, starts fire suppression mechanism 2 and fire source is put out.If fire source intensity is smaller at this time, the first outlet pipe
Solenoid valve 7 on 221 is closed, and the solenoid valve 7 on the second outlet pipe 222 is opened, while the first actuator 5 and the second actuator 6
The angle of adjustment jet pipe 44 is worked at the same time, until jet pipe 44 is directed at fire source, fire source can be carried out concentrating at this time and put out by water;If fiery
Source strength is larger, then the solenoid valve 7 on the second outlet pipe 222 is closed, and the solenoid valve 7 on the first outlet pipe 221 is opened, thus shape
At the biggish water curtain of water, to slow down the speed of fire spreading, strive for more fleeing from the time to personnel in building;If fire source
Intensity is medium, then 7 solenoid valve 7 of solenoid valve on the second outlet pipe 222 and the first outlet pipe 221 is opened, to put out a fire one on one side
Side forms water curtain, to attempt to put out a fire and prevent fire spreading.
